Understanding Cannabidiol (CBD)
CBD, short for cannabidiol, is a fascinating compound derived from the cannabis plant. Unlike its more famous cousin, THC, CBD is non-intoxicating, meaning it doesn't produce the "high" sensation often associated with cannabis. This fundamental difference is a key reason for its widespread appeal in the wellness community.
What is CBD and Where Does it Come From?
CBD is one of over a hundred cannabinoids found in the Cannabis sativa plant, a species that includes both hemp and marijuana. While it’s an active ingredient in medical marijuana, CBD used in wellness products is typically derived directly from the hemp plant or, in some cases, manufactured synthetically. Hemp plants are specifically cultivated to contain very low levels of THC (typically less than 0.2% in the UK), making them ideal for producing non-intoxicating CBD products.
The distinction between hemp and marijuana is crucial:
- Hemp: Legally defined as Cannabis sativa plants with very low THC content. It’s primarily grown for its fibre, seeds, and CBD content.
- Marijuana: Refers to Cannabis sativa plants with higher THC content, cultivated for its psychoactive properties.

CBD vs. THC: A Clear Distinction
The primary psychoactive component of cannabis is THC (delta-9-tetrahydrocannabinol), which is responsible for the euphoric effects. CBD, however, interacts with the body in a much different way. It does not bind to the cannabinoid receptors in the brain with the same direct affinity as THC, which is why it doesn't cause intoxication.
Instead, CBD's pharmacological profile is complex and still being fully understood. It interacts with several receptors in both the central and peripheral nervous systems. This broad interaction is what makes CBD a subject of such extensive research and interest for its potential to support a variety of physiological processes, without the psychoactive effects.

The Endocannabinoid System (ECS) and CBD
To understand how CBD may support our well-being, it's essential to first grasp the concept of the endocannabinoid system (ECS). This intricate system plays a pivotal role in maintaining internal balance, or homeostasis, within the body.
What is the ECS and How Does it Work?
The ECS is a complex cell-signalling system identified in the early 1990s by researchers exploring THC. It exists in all mammals and is involved in regulating a wide range of bodily functions, including mood, sleep, appetite, memory, and various physiological responses.
The ECS comprises three main components:
- Endocannabinoids: These are cannabinoid-like molecules naturally produced by your body. The two primary endocannabinoids are anandamide (AEA) and 2-arachidonoylglycerol (2-AG). They are "on-demand" molecules, meaning your body produces them when needed and then quickly breaks them down.
- Cannabinoid Receptors: These receptors are found throughout your body, primarily in the brain (CB1 receptors) and in immune cells, the gut, and other peripheral organs (CB2 receptors). Endocannabinoids bind to these receptors to signal the ECS to take action.
- Enzymes: These proteins break down endocannabinoids once they have performed their function. Fatty acid amide hydrolase (FAAH) breaks down anandamide, and monoacylglycerol lipase (MAGL) breaks down 2-AG.
The ECS acts like a master regulator, ensuring that various systems in your body remain in optimal balance. When something is out of whack, the ECS steps in to try and restore equilibrium.
How CBD Interacts with the ECS
Unlike THC, which directly binds to CB1 receptors to produce its effects, CBD interacts with the ECS in a more indirect and nuanced way. Researchers believe CBD’s mechanisms include:
- Indirectly Enhancing Endocannabinoid Levels: CBD has been shown to inhibit the FAAH enzyme, which is responsible for breaking down anandamide. By slowing down the breakdown of anandamide, CBD may allow this natural endocannabinoid to remain in the system longer, potentially enhancing its beneficial effects. Elevated anandamide levels are thought to contribute to feelings of calm and well-being.
- Interacting with Other Receptors: CBD is known to have interactions with several non-cannabinoid receptors in the body. For instance, it may influence serotonin 5-HT1A receptors, which are involved in mood regulation. It also interacts with transient receptor potential vanilloid type 1 (TRPV1) receptors, which play a role in discomfort perception and general well-being.
- Modulating Receptor Activity: Some research suggests that CBD may also modulate the activity of CB1 and CB2 receptors, though it doesn't bind to them directly in the same way THC does. This modulation could influence how other cannabinoids, including endocannabinoids, interact with these receptors.
By supporting the natural functioning of the ECS and interacting with other key receptors, CBD may contribute to a broader sense of internal balance. CBD’s interaction with serotonin receptors, specifically the 5-HT1A receptor, is of particular interest to researchers. Serotonin is a crucial neurotransmitter often referred to as a "feel-good" chemical, playing a significant role in regulating mood and overall emotional well-being.
By influencing these receptors, CBD may help support the body's natural mechanisms for maintaining balanced moods. Oils and Tinctures
CBD oils and tinctures are popular for their versatility and potential for rapid absorption when taken sublingually (under the tongue). This method allows CBD to bypass the digestive system and enter the bloodstream more directly.
- Best for: Those seeking a flexible dosage and quicker onset of potential effects.

When beginning with CBD, the mantra "start low and go slow" is incredibly important. Everyone’s body chemistry is unique, and what works for one person may not work for another. It’s about finding your individual sweet spot.
- Start with a small dose: Begin with the lowest recommended dose on the product label.
- Observe and adjust: Pay attention to how your body responds over several days. If you feel you need more support, gradually increase the dosage.
- Consistency is crucial: CBD, like many wellness supplements, often works best when taken consistently over time. Building a routine, whether it's daily or a few times a week, allows your body to integrate the benefits more effectively. Think of it as supporting your body’s natural systems rather than an immediate 'fix.'
Remember, consult a healthcare professional if you are pregnant, breastfeeding, taking medication, or under medical supervision before starting any new supplement regimen.
